您好,登錄后才能下訂單哦!
Kafka是一個分布式流處理平臺,用于實時處理數據流。PHP是一種流行的服務器端腳本語言,常用于開發Web應用程序。灰度發布是一種逐步發布新功能或更新的策略,可以幫助開發團隊降低發布風險和檢測潛在問題。在使用Kafka和PHP進行灰度發布時,可以采取以下策略:
利用Kafka進行消息隊列發布:將新功能或更新發布到Kafka消息隊列中,然后逐步將消息傳遞給PHP應用程序,以確保新功能或更新在所有實例中逐步生效。
使用Kafka的消費者組:在Kafka中創建多個消費者組,每個消費者組對應一個不同的PHP實例。通過這種方式,可以控制誰接收新功能或更新,從而實現灰度發布。
監控和回滾:在灰度發布過程中,需要監控PHP應用程序的性能和穩定性。如果發現問題,可以快速回滾到之前的版本,以避免對用戶造成影響。
總的來說,結合Kafka和PHP進行灰度發布可以幫助開發團隊更加靈活地控制功能發布過程,確保最終用戶體驗的穩定性和可靠性。
免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。